Black Towel records a brief intimate encounter between
a brown man and a white Austrian woman.
What begins as an innocent exchange of polite talk
and banter over drinks and cigarettes quickly turns
into casual sex, which albeit frivolous, portends
far darker issues of racial prejudice.
The film, spanning roughly twenty two minutes, attempts
to understand perceived notions and widely held beliefs
about immigrants, color, cultural schisms and race.
Though it doesn’t claim to be the definitive
tract on the subject, the Black towel serves as a
micro-narrative on multiculturalism and how an indigenous
populace views the phenomenon.
